Bermuda's Overseas Footballers/Coaches Round-Up

IslandStats.com
Khano Smith

Rhode Island FC, Head Coach and General Manager Khano Smith began his historic inaugural USL Championship match at Beirne Stadium came to a dramatic close in a 1-1 draw against New Mexico United.

The physical matchup from start to finish was highlighted by a sold-out atmosphere of fans and supporters coming together to witness the Ocean State’s only professional soccer team take the pitch for the very first time.

Despite being down 1-0 deep into second-half stoppage time, the sold-out crowd came alive when New Mexico defender Christopher Gloster recorded an own goal off a dangerous Noah Fuson cross for the first goal in RIFC history.

The late strike secured the 1-1 draw and earned Rhode Island its first-ever USL Championship point, sending fans across Beirne Stadium into euphoria as fireworks erupted.

David Bascome

David Bascome’s Baltimore Blast defeated the Harrisburg Heat 7 – 5.

The Baltimore Blast held a 3 – 0 lead after the first period, they would hold a 3 – 2 lead at the half, both teams scored two goals in the third period as the Blast led 5 – 4, the Baltimore Blast would then outscore Harrisburg 2 – 1 in the final period top claim the victory.

Dom Alvarado would lead the Baltimore Blast with 2 goals, while Jamie Thomas, Victor Parreiras, Jereme Raley, Tony Donatelli, and Moises Gonzalez all added a goal each.

Leilanni Nesbeth

Leilanni Nesbeth watched from the sidelines as her Chicago Red Stars teammates kicked off their 2024 campaign with a 2 – 0 win over Utah Royals FC in the Royals’ inaugural match back in the National Women’s Soccer League.

Ally Schlegel and Ava Cook provided the two goals for the Red Stars and were backed by an outstanding performance by goalkeeper Alyssa Naeher.

Nahki Wells

Two goals either side of half-time meant Nahki Wells and his Bristol City teammates fell to a defeat at West Bromwich Albion.

Goals from Tom Fellows and Jed Wallace proved the difference, taking Albion’s unbeaten run to six games.

Tommy Conway, Jason Knight, and Mark Sykes all came close for City but despite their best efforts could not convert their chances.

Reggie Lambe

Reggie Lambe and his Braintree Town FC teammates edged Weymouth FC 1 – 0 at the Bob Lucas Stadium.
